I see these pieces and think “they sent two extra, must be real important to replace often!” My printer has been working fine for… WebA simple example of conventional impression die forging is illustrated in Figure 5-11. As the two dies approach, the workpiece undergoes plastic deformation, flowing laterally until it touches the side walls of the impression. A small amount of metal continues to flow outside of the impression, forming flash. As the dies continue to approach, the flash is thinned …

WebA flash can act as a cushion for impact blows form the finishing impression and also help to restrict the outward flow of metal, thus helping in filling of thin ribs and bosses in the upper die. The amount of flash depends on the forging size and may vary from 10 to 50 per cent. The flash flows around the forging in the parting plane.
